Insider Information When You're Buying Fences
Maybe you want to buy a fence but you're really not sure what is the best thing to get. So first ask yourself what is most important to you because that's the most important thing. Maybe you have the family pet or pets, and you need a fence for them, but there are other purposes, too. In addition to adding some security, a well designed and chosen fence can put just the right amount of color and decor, too.
It's really just a matter of courtesy to consider others who are living next to you and behind you.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. This is really easy to check on, and you can even find out probably online regarding zoning requirements and permits for this and that. The thing about this is you are unfortunately not able to put something you want on your property because you want it - you need various permissions sometimes.
If you want to make the place where you live more attractive, you can do that with certain kinds of fencing. If your backgarden is bare, then slow down and do some landscape planning so you'll know what to get. What's so much fun about this is it's a creative outlet, and everybody needs a little bit of that in life. As you may know, landscapers do this sort of thing every day, and they'll be sure to give you some killer ideas.
Millions of people have dogs, and they like to have the back garden fenced in for that reason only. If this is the case, you can have a boundary fence or a rail fence, but you'll need to install something at the base such as chicken wire to keep the pet in the garden. You'll discover that there are plenty of solutions that are workable with some being more expensive than others. There are many other things you should take into consideration, and it's a good idea to speak with the fencing company.
Taking care of what you need to know before buying your fence is just the smart way to go. And if you're going with ornamental, then you'll need to think in different terms. Things are different today than decades ago, and you can find a fence that will complement the rest of your property.
